2094 Details : Add new ->l_weigh_ast() call-back to ldlm_lock. It is called
2095 by ldlm_cancel_shrink_policy() to estimate lock "value", instead of
2096 hard-coded `number of pages' logic.
2100 Description: Add lockdep annotations to llog code.
2101 Details : Use appropriately tagged _nested() locking calls in the places
2102 where llog takes more than one ->lgh_lock lock.
2106 Description: Add loi_kms_set().
2107 Details : Wrap kms updates into a helper function.
2111 Description: Constify instances of struct lsm_operations.
2112 Details : Constify instances of struct lsm_operations.
2116 Description: lu_conf support.
2117 Details : On a server, a file system object is uniquely identified
2118 by a fid, which is sufficient to locate and load all object
2119 state (inode). On a client, on the other hand, more data are
2120 necessary instantiate an object. Change lu_object_find() and
2121 friends to take additional `lu_conf' argument describing object.
2122 Typically this includes layout information.
2126 Description: lu_context fixes.
2127 Details : Introduce new lu_context functions that are needed on the client
2128 side, where some system threads (ptlrpcd) are shared by multiple
2129 modules, and so cannot be stopped during module shutdown.
2133 Description: Add start and stop methods to lu_device_type_operations.
2134 Details : Introduce two new methods in lu_device_type_operations, that are
2135 invoked when first instance of a given type is created and last one
2136 is destroyed respectively. This is need by CLIO.
2140 Description: Add lu_ref support to struct lu_device.
2141 Details : Add lu_ref support to lu_object and lu_device. lu_ref is used to
2142 track leaked references.
2146 Description: Introduce lu_kmem_descr.
2147 Details : lu_kmem_descr and its companion interface allow to create
2148 and destroy a number of kmem caches at once.
2152 Description: Fix lu_object finalization race.
2153 Details : Fix a race between lu_object_find() finding an object and its

3012 Frequency : occasional, depends on client load and configuration
3013 Bugzilla : 12181, 12203
3014 Description: data loss for recently-modified files
3016 Details : In some cases it is possible that recently written or created
3017 files may not be written to disk in a timely manner (this should
3018 normally be within 30s unless client IO load is very high).
3019 The problem appears as zero-length files or files that are a
3020 multiple of 1MB in size after a client crash or client eviction
3021 that are missing data at the end of the file.
3023 This problem is more likely to be hit on clients where files are
3024 repeatedly created and unlinked in the same directory, clients
3025 have a large amount of RAM, have many CPUs, the filesystem has
3026 many OSTs, the clients are rebooted frequently, and/or the files
3027 are not accessed by other nodes after being written.
3029 The presence of the problem can be detected by looking at
3030 /proc/sys/fs/inode-state. If the first number (nr_inodes) is
3031 smaller than the second (nr_unused) then dirty files will not
3032 be flushed automatically to disk. "sync; sleep 10" should be
3033 run several times on the node before unmounting it to update
3034 Lustre (this is also safe to run on nodes without this problem).
3036 There is also a related kernel bug in the RHEL4 4 2.6.9 kernel
3037 that can cause this same problem, so customers using that kernel
3038 also need to update the kernel in addition to Lustre. In order
3039 to properly fix this bug, the RHEL3 2.4.21 kernel is also updated.
3041 It is normal that files written just before a client crash (less
3042 than 30s) may not yet have been flushed to disk, even for local
